Formula 1 teams agree cost-cutting package
Formula 1 teams have agreed to a package of cost-cutting changes to help the sport ride out the coronavirus pandemic, BBC Sport can reveal. Teams voted to accept a plan to lower the budget cap to be introduced next year by $30m to $145m (£118.6m). This will be reduced again to $140m in 2022 and $135m for the period 2023-25. This is one of a series of measures aimed at reducing costs and levelling the field, including a research-and-development handicap system. The package still needs to be officially approved by F1's legislative body, the world motorsport council of governing body the FIA.
